Eviction Risk in Heatherstone , Carolina Forest

1 census tracts · pop 2,469 · pop-weighted composite 5.8/10 · range 5.8–5.8

Heatherstone is a white (non-hispanic) neighborhood in Carolina Forest with 1 census tract and a population of 2,469 residents. The neighborhood's pop-weighted eviction-risk score of 5.8/10 (Moderate tier) blends state law, county-level filing rates, parent-city politics, and tract-specific rent burden + poverty. 47% of renters here pay at least 30% of household income on rent, and 28% are severely cost-burdened (≥50% of income). Median gross rent of $1,476/month sits 12% lower than the Carolina Forest citywide median ($1,668).
